Hair loss can be caused by a number of factors, including stress, diet, biological hereditary causes, and use of too many chemical treatments on the hair. All of these can lead to embarrassing and unsightly loss of hair. Women often experience thinning and bald patches, while men generally lose their hair slowly as their hair line recedes.

Hair implants are another option. Many companies specialize in using hair grafts so individuals can have a thick head of hair again. These are permanent but expensive. They are only recommended for those that cannot re-grow hair through any other means such as shampoos or pills. Hair implants are different from extensions, because they are actually placed inside the scalp through special technology.
Extensions for those with rapid hair loss are also a great and affordable option. There are temporary extensions as well as sewn in extensions that can last longer. The only downside to sewn-in hair extensions is that they can cause increased hair loss if you do not get them put in properly! This is the last thing anyone with hair problems wants, so think about it before trying. Extensions can cost between $100 and $3,000 depending on where you go and what you want done.
The last and least desirable option for those suffering from hair loss is to use wigs. There are many styles and types to choose from. Many are even made with human hair and look quite natural. You can change your style often, and even go crazy and try hot pink hair. Wigs do look good but some people simply aren’t happy with wearing fake hair everyday.
